Basic Course
The certified beginners course for sailing on multihulls provides basic practical and theoretical knowledge of catamaran sailing. During the whole course you will have an experienced catamaran instructor directly at your side. You will sit at the helm or jib from the first lesson and thus sail the catamaran yourself.
The Catamaran Basic Certificate course includes 10 hours with an instructor and at least 2 hours of free sailing. At the end you can decide if you want to take the exam for the Catamaran Basic License International of the VDWS ((extra € 40.00). With this license you can sail or rent catamarans at VDWS stations worldwide.
You will learn basic sailing skills as well as gain catamaran specific competence:
- Reading the wind and water
- Courses to the wind
- Tacking
- Jibing
- Speed control
- Capsize and righting
- Parking
- Right of way
- Knowledge of the boat and it’s components
- Nautical knots
- Safety topics
Catamaran Advanced Course
This course is the perfect upgrade to the VDWS Catamaran basic license. Depending on the level of knowledge, the course content is determined individually and thus builds on your actual skill level.
Content of the advanced course:
- Boat- weight and sail trim
- Wind Course training
- Maneuver training
- Strong wind training
- Helmsman and crew training
- Regatta tactics
- Righting methods
